Revisiting a Visionary

In the heart of New York City, a profound homage has emerged at the AIDS Memorial, a space that embodies both remembrance and resilience. The recent commission by contemporary artist Oscar Tuazon pays tribute to Scott Burton, a pioneering figure in the intersection of art and activism. Known for his innovative approach to public sculptures, Burton’s final work serves as a poignant reminder of the ongoing battle against HIV/AIDS, while seamlessly integrating into the memorial’s ethos.

The Essence of Scott Burton

Scott Burton was not merely an artist; he was a cultural commentator whose works often blurred the boundaries between functional design and conceptual art. His sculptures are characterized by their engaging forms and thoughtful placements, inviting viewers to interact on multiple levels. Burton’s legacy is enriched by his commitment to social issues, making his art not only aesthetically pleasing but also deeply significant.

Oscar Tuazon’s Interpretation

Oscar Tuazon’s interpretation of Burton’s vision encapsulates the spirit of both artists. By reimagining Burton’s final public work, Tuazon brings a contemporary lens to a historical context. His creation reflects an understanding of the intricate layers of meaning inherent in Burton’s oeuvre, while also resonating with today’s dialogues surrounding community, loss, and healing. This new sculpture invites visitors to engage with the memorial actively, fostering a sense of connection and reflection.
